In terms of specific competencies, Mr. McCarthy's Department was asked to contract accommodation on a scale it would never have been asked to do before. Currently, the Department is trying to reconfigure that accommodation in terms of the temporary protection applicants who are increasingly leaving that accommodation. The Department is trying to consolidate and ensure we are increasing standards and encourage some of those accommodation providers to move into international protection. Does the Department have the relevant competencies within it to deal with those types of contract negotiations? I share the worry of other Deputies that many people in the private sector are making a lot of money from our response to this crisis. Does the Department have that competency within it to drive a hard bargain on the part of the State to ensure we are getting the best value for money and also in terms of the consolidation piece to ensure we are moving to higher quality providers and that people are getting a better standard of service? Are we being successful in converting some of the temporary protection accommodation to international protection, where we are seeing increasing pressures?
